Leading With Your Best

  • Flexible with scheduling and available to work retail hours, which may include day, evening, weekends, and/or holidays, based on department and store/company needs.

  • Physical requirements include the ability to bend, squat, reach, climb a ladder and stand for extended periods of time with or without reasonable accommodations.

The starting hourly rate for this position isㅤ$15.50
  • Must be at least 18 (U.S.)

An online assessment is part of the application process for this role. During the assessment, you’ll be asked questions that give you the chance to demonstrate your personality and behavioral preferences by choosing between statements. The questions are directed at personality characteristics that relate to successful performance in the Retail Athlete/Associate role at NIKE. NIKE uses the scores from this assessment as part of determining who to advance in the hiring process.
